Output 35d0520adb8358b965ab5bc8f07783cfd2ff211628b496f83552bdb5cfa3623c:2

value
103312303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83788470b1a2508ca21084ea689198db1bc6654e OP_EQUAL
address
MKtK8FZZQL7Bdj2DvXPh3dXBgbBFsy6PR4
transaction
35d0520adb8358b965ab5bc8f07783cfd2ff211628b496f83552bdb5cfa3623c
spent
true